DETROIT (WWJ) -- Detroit police are looking for four suspects, all believed to be teenagers, in connection with a home invasion and armed robbery on the city's west side.

Just after 1 p.m. on Wednesday, July 26, police said the robbers forced their way into a home in the 6700 block of Warwick, in the area of W. Warren Ave. and Evergreen Rd.

One of the suspects pointed a gun at a 59-year-old residents and demanded his wallet, police said, while another pointed a gun at an 18-year-old resident, before taking his cell phone.

The suspects then away from the scene.

No one was hurt.

Police said the suspects were males, approximately 15 to 18 years old. All of them were wearing black clothing, with their faces covered with black masks at the time of the crime.

The Detroit Police Department released two images of the suspects, taken from a home surveliene camera, on Friday.
